limited slip into an 85 GS

How hard is it to put a limited slip diff. from a GSL into a 85 GS. My friend is going to sell me a GSL that was in an accident as it will be too much to try to fix it. I thought that I could take some parts like the leather seats and the limited slip if it is not too hard to change. What other parts could be taken and changed easily?

basically, you can swap the entire rear end over. It's not that hard, really just drop your rear end, and slap the other one in, connect a few lines and away you go.

Your gonna have disk brakes now,so depending on the shape
of the brake lines on the parts car,and are they both 5 speeds ?
you "may" need the drive shaft too,,it's not that bad,to change
rear ends,you'll just need brake fluid,,,I did it !! to my 82 GS
oh ,,and some rear end ,LSD gear oil too,,

What about the brake proportioning valve?? You'll probably need to switch that as well.

I'm assuming your going more for the luxury thing and performance is less of a concern to you... cause if you're concerned about adding weight to your car, forget about the leather and power windows. I was amazed just how heavy those leather seats and door panels are. As for the power windows, you can install the motor and hardware (not the easiest job in the world, but its possible), but you might change your mind once you actually feel how heavy this stuff is!
